持续封闭负压引流在电击伤后皮肤及软组织损伤中的应用

摘    要:目的探讨持续封闭负压引流在修复高压电击伤后皮肤及软组织缺损中的疗效。方法32例高压电击伤创面早期清创,一期行持续封闭负压引流,运用其专用敷料覆盖,生物半透膜封闭,视创面情况定期更换敷料,待创面培养出新鲜肉芽组织,二期采用皮辩移植或游离皮片移植封闭创面,观察术后皮瓣及皮片的成活情况。结果16例使用1次持续封闭负压引流后,创面新鲜、肉芽组织生长良好;10例使用2次(更换一次敷料)后创面新鲜、肉芽组织丰富,二期行刃厚皮片或中厚皮片移植,皮片均存活良好;16例创面伴有骨外露,行邻位或随意皮瓣转移,皮瓣存活良好。结论持续封闭负压引流能提高皮片或皮瓣移植成活率,减少创面植皮次数,缩短病程,减轻患者痛苦,便于操作和护理,在治疗电击伤后皮肤及软组织缺损中有良好的临床应用前景。

The Application of Vacuum Sealing Drainage in Repair of the Skin and Tissue Defects after High Voltage Electrical Injury

Abstract:Objective Explore the effect of vacuum sealing drainage in repair of the skin and tissue defects after high voltage electrical injury. Methods According to 32 cases of high voltage electrical injury from 2010 July to 2012 July treated by early wound debridement in our hospital, a period of sustained a vacuum sealing drainage,using the special dressing and biological semiper- meable membrane closing, change dressing as the wound regularly, after the wound to produce fresh granulation tissue, using the skin flap transplantation or free skin graft to close the wound, observation the survival situation of postoperative flap and skin graft. Re- sults In 16 patients, the wound became fresh and the granulation tissue growth well after using 1 continuous vacuum sealing drain- age. In other 10 patients, the wound became fresh and the granulation tissue growth well after using 2 continuous vacuum sealing drain- age, then the wound edge thickness skin graft or split-thickness skin graft, skin grafts were living well. Among 16 cases of wound with bone exposure, for flap or free flap, flaps survival well. Conclusion Vact~um sealing drainage can improve the survival rate of the skin flap and skin graft, reduce the number of wound skin grafting, shorten the course of disease, alleviate the suffering of patients,and easy to nursing care, so in repair of the skin and tissue defects after high voltage electrical injury with a good prospect of clinical appli- cation.
